C-reactive protein

CRP is made by the liver during inflammation. It rises and falls quickly, which makes it useful for detecting an active process and for judging whether other markers can be trusted.

What CRP measures

When inflammation starts anywhere in the body, signalling molecules reach the liver, which responds by producing C-reactive protein. Levels can rise a thousandfold within a day or two and fall just as quickly once the cause resolves.

That speed is both its strength and its limit. CRP tells you that something inflammatory is happening and roughly how intense it is, but it says nothing about where or why. A chest infection and an autoimmune flare can produce the same number.

A separate high-sensitivity assay, hs-CRP, measures the low end of the range precisely and is used in cardiovascular risk assessment rather than for detecting infection.

Why it gets tested

To detect or monitor infection and inflammatory disease, to follow recovery after surgery, and — as hs-CRP — as one component of cardiovascular risk assessment. It is also measured alongside ferritin to check whether a normal ferritin can be believed.

Commonly associated with low values

  • No detectable inflammatory activity at the time of the test

Commonly associated with high values

  • Bacterial infection, typically producing the highest values
  • Autoimmune or inflammatory disease during a flare
  • Tissue injury, including after surgery
  • Persistent mild elevation in obesity and metabolic syndrome

What can shift the result

  • Intense exercise in the preceding days raises CRP
  • A minor cold at the time of testing is enough to lift the value
  • Combined oral contraceptives and hormone therapy raise baseline CRP

Questions

What is the difference between CRP and hs-CRP?

They measure the same protein with different precision. Standard CRP is designed to detect the large rises seen in infection and inflammation. High-sensitivity CRP resolves the low end of the range accurately and is used to assess cardiovascular risk, where the differences of interest are small.

Does a raised CRP mean something serious?

Not on its own. CRP indicates that an inflammatory process is active, not what is causing it — a common cold, a recent hard training session or a healing injury all raise it. It is interpreted in the context of symptoms and other findings, never alone.
